AI小龙虾安装失败的终极解决方案,从诊断到修复一步到位

openclaw OpenClaw帮助 1

目录导读

  1. 问题概述:什么是“AI小龙虾”及其安装困境
  2. 核心诊断:五大常见安装失败原因深度解析
  3. 分步修复:手把手教你解决安装错误
  4. 预防措施:确保未来安装成功的优化配置
  5. 专家问答:关于AI工具安装的典型疑惑解答

问题概述:什么是“AI小龙虾”及其安装困境

“AI小龙虾”并非指代真正的海鲜,而是在AI开发社区与自动化爱好者中流传的一个趣味性术语,它通常隐喻那些功能强大但配置复杂、依赖繁多的AI工具包或开源项目,这些工具如同小龙虾般,外壳(安装部署)坚硬棘手,但内在(功能价值)鲜美丰富,用户在实际安装过程中,常常会遭遇“AI小龙虾安装失败”的窘境,具体表现为:依赖包冲突、环境配置报错、权限不足、网络下载超时或硬件兼容性问题等,导致核心功能无法正常部署和运行。

AI小龙虾安装失败的终极解决方案,从诊断到修复一步到位-第1张图片-OpenClaw官网 - 龙虾本地部署|安装下载

核心诊断:五大常见安装失败原因深度解析

要解决问题,首先需精准定位病因,以下是导致安装失败的五大核心原因:

  • 环境依赖缺失或冲突:这是最常见的“拦路虎”,许多AI项目依赖于特定版本的Python、CUDA(用于GPU加速)、PyTorch或TensorFlow等库,版本不匹配或缺少关键系统组件(如C++编译环境)会直接导致安装脚本中止。
  • 系统权限与路径问题:在Windows、macOS或Linux系统中,没有以管理员或root权限运行安装命令,或安装路径包含中文字符、特殊符号,都可能引发写入错误。
  • 网络连接与源配置不当:在下载大型模型文件或从GitHub、PyPI仓库拉取代码时,网络不稳定或默认镜像源速度慢、不可用,会造成下载失败。
  • 硬件不兼容或驱动过时:如果项目需要GPU加速,而用户的显卡驱动版本过低,或CUDA工具包版本与深度学习框架要求不符,安装便会失败。
  • 项目本身的Bug或文档过时:开源项目更新频繁,有时安装指南未能及时同步最新改动,或代码中存在已知但尚未修复的缺陷。

分步修复:手把手教你解决安装错误

面对失败,请保持冷静,按照以下系统化步骤进行排查和修复:

第一步:复查官方文档与环境要求 前往项目的官方GitHub仓库或文档站(openalaw.com.cn 上发布的指南),逐条核对Python版本、操作系统、CUDA版本等“硬性要求”。

第二步:创建并激活独立的虚拟环境 强烈建议使用condavenv创建一个纯净的Python虚拟环境,这能完美隔离不同项目间的依赖冲突。

conda create -n ai_crawfish python=3.9
conda activate ai_crawfish

第三步:使用镜像源加速依赖安装 更换pip或conda的软件源至国内镜像(如清华、阿里云源),能极大提升包下载成功率与速度。

pip install -r requirements.txt -i https://pypi.tuna.tsinghua.edu.cn/simple

第四步:逐一安装并处理报错 不要一次性安装所有依赖,可尝试先安装核心框架(如PyTorch),再根据错误提示逐个解决缺失的库,对于需要编译的库,确保已安装如build-essential(Linux)或Visual Studio Build Tools(Windows)等编译环境。

第五步:寻求社区帮助与替代方案 如果以上步骤均无效,可将完整的错误日志复制到项目Issue区或相关技术论坛搜索,有时,选择更稳定的历史版本安装是快速有效的权宜之计,您也可以关注 openalaw.com.cn 等专业站点,它们时常会发布已验证的集成安装包或详细教程。

提示:对于某些复杂的AI工具链,如果本地安装反复失败,可以考虑使用Docker容器化部署,它能提供开箱即用的标准环境。

预防措施:确保未来安装成功的优化配置

  • 养成使用虚拟环境的习惯:这是AI开发者的最佳实践之首。
  • 维护清晰的版本管理记录:使用pip freeze > requirements.txt记录成功环境的所有包及版本。
  • 保持驱动与基础软件更新:定期更新显卡驱动、操作系统关键补丁。
  • 善用高效工具:对于大型开源项目,可以先尝试通过可靠的渠道获取预配置的资源,在进行相关AI工具探索时,一个有效的起点或许是获取经过验证的启动器,您可以尝试进行 OpenClaw下载 来简化初始步骤,其官方获取地址为:https://openalaw.com.cn/

专家问答:关于AI工具安装的典型疑惑解答

Q1:安装时提示“Could not find a version that satisfies the requirement…”,我该怎么办? A1:这通常意味着当前配置的镜像源中没有找到对应版本的包,首先检查包名是否拼写错误;尝试更换镜像源或指定一个更宽泛的版本范围(如numpy>=1.19);可以访问PyPI官网手动查看该包的可供版本。

Q2:错误信息指向CUDA相关错误,但我确认已安装CUDA,问题何在? A2:请精确检查“三位一体”的版本匹配:显卡驱动版本CUDA Toolkit版本、以及PyTorch/TensorFlow所要求的CUDA版本必须兼容,建议使用nvidia-sminvcc --version命令分别查看驱动支持的CUDA最高版本和当前安装的CUDA运行时版本。

Q3:在Windows上安装需要编译的包(如dlib)总是失败,有何捷径? A3:Windows上编译环境配置复杂,最直接的方法是访问第三方非官方预编译库网站(如Christoph Gohlke维护的站点),直接下载对应Python版本和系统的.whl文件进行本地安装。

Q4:如何判断是项目本身的问题还是我环境的问题? A4:一个快速的验证方法是:在Git仓库的Issue列表中搜索你的错误关键词,如果发现有大量近期用户报告相同错误,且没有明确解决方案,很可能是项目的新版Bug,回退到上一个稳定版本(tag)安装通常是明智的选择。

“AI小龙虾安装失败”是一个典型的系统工程问题,需要耐心、系统的排查和对基础知识的理解,通过遵循标准化的安装流程、善用社区资源并优化个人开发环境,绝大多数安装难题都能迎刃而解,在AI技术探索的道路上,解决问题的过程本身也是宝贵的学习之旅。

标签: AI小龙虾 安装修复

抱歉,评论功能暂时关闭!